Linux达人养成计划I——目录处理命令
它可以列出当前工作目录中的所有文件和子目录,您可以使用相对路径或绝对路径来指定要进入的目录。rmdir emptydir5. cpcp用于复制文件或目录。
作为一名Linux爱好者,我们需要掌握各种命令来轻松处理各种任务。在本篇文章中,我们将介绍目录处理命令。这些命令可以帮助您管理文件夹和文件,并让您更加高效地完成工作。
1. ls
ls是最常用的目录处理命令之一。它可以列出当前工作目录中的所有文件和子目录,并显示它们的详细信息,例如权限、所有者、大小和日期等。以下是几个常用选项:
– -a:显示所有文件(包括隐藏文件)。
– -l:以长格式显示。
– -t:按修改时间排序。
– -r:反向排序。
示例:
“`
ls
ls -al
ls -ltr
2. cd
cd是进入指定目录的命令。您可以使用相对路径或绝对路径来指定要进入的目录。
cd /home/user/Documents
cd ..
cd ../..
3. mkdir
mkdir用于创建新目录。
mkdir newdir
mkdir dir1 dir2 dir3
![Linux达人养成计划I——目录处理命令缩略图 Linux达人养成计划I——目录处理命令](https://www.72715.net/wp-content/uploads/2023/05/d60c9500b01769b72aee50a522c8f8c7.png)
4. rmdir
rmdir用于删除空目录。
rmdir emptydir
5. cp
cp用于复制文件或目录。
cp file1 file2
cp -r dir1 dir2
6. mv
mv用于移动或重命名文件或目录。
mv file1 newfile
mv olddir newdir
7. rm
rm用于删除文件或目录。请注意,一旦删除,文件将无法恢复。
rm file1
rm -r dir1
8. find
find用于在指定的目录中查找符合条件的文件。以下是几个常用选项:
– -name:按名称查找。
– -type:按类型查找。
– -size:按大小查找。
find /home/user/Documents/ -name “*.txt”
find /home/user/Documents/ -type f
find /home/user/Documents/ -size +10M
Linux达人养成计划I——目录处理命令就介绍到这里了。希望这些命令能够帮助您更好地管理您的Linux系统,并使您更加高效地完成工作!